St. George School in Saint Louis, MO offers co–educational Catholic education for grades K through 8 in an urban community setting.
The school enrolls 154 udents with a student–teacher ratio of 13:1 supported by 12 teachers.
George School is a member of the National Catholic Educational Association (NCEA) and provides a faith–based curriculum aligned with Catholic values.
The udent population includes approximately 3.5% students of color, reflecting some degree of diversity within the school community.
Tuition and specific fees are not lied, but the school is located near multiple K–8 private schools in Saint Louis with similar grade offerings and student capacities.
